BANGALORE, India, April 25, 2025 /PRNewswire/ — Photo Detector Market is Segmented by Type (Portable Type, Stationary Type), by Application (Consumer Electronics, Industrial Equipment, Aerospace And Defense, Automobile).

The Global Photo Detector Market was valued at USD 3510.1 Million in 2023 and is anticipated to reach USD 5918.5 Million by 2030, witnessing a CAGR of 7.6% during the forecast period 2024-2030.

Major Factors Driving the Growth of Photo Detector Market:

Demand for photo detectors is accelerating because optical sensing has become a foundational layer of digital transformation across industries. Smartphones, wearables, ADAS vehicles, smart-buildings, drones, biomedical test kits, and quantum-secure networks all rely on photodiodes, SPAD arrays, or CMOS image sensors to convert light into actionable data. Every new feature such as face authentication, lidar depth mapping, fluorescence-based diagnostics, hyperspectral crop analysis, or single-photon encryption in turn adds more detector channels per device. At the same time, manufacturing efficiencies and government semiconductor incentives are pushing device prices down, widening the addressable pool of applications. Tighter safety, energy-efficiency, and quality regulations further mandate redundant optical sensors in consumer and industrial equipment, turning photodetectors from optional components into non-negotiable design wins and locking in multiyear shipment growth.

TRENDS INFLUENCING THE GROWTH OF THE PHOTO DETECTOR MARKET:

Portable photodetectors convert smartphones, wearables, drone payloads, and field-testing gadgets into ubiquitous optical laboratories, shifting measurement from centralized benches to the network edge. Integration with low-power microcontrollers lets environmental scientists verify air quality on mountain trails and agronomists gauge chlorophyll in remote paddies, all without mains electricity. High-volume handset manufacturing cuts module cost below a dollar, making photoplethysmography and time-of-flight depth mapping commonplace in consumer devices. This mass adoption primes suppliers with cash flow to fund R&D for ultraviolet-C pathogen detection. Start-ups exploit open Bluetooth profiles to link photodiodes with cloud dashboards, spawning subscription services for athletes, diabetics, and construction inspectors, thus transforming one-time hardware sales into durable recurring revenue.

Stationary photodetector systems, anchored in traffic intersections, semiconductor fabs, and utility substations, serve applications where stability, throughput, and calibration precision outweigh mobility. Smart-city planners layer lidar-based monitors with multispectral cameras to quantify vehicle counts, pedestrian flow, and emissions in real time, feeding AI engines that optimize signal timing and congestion pricing. In manufacturing, fixed spectrophotometers inspect wafer lithography or beverage clarity at line rates exceeding ten-thousand samples per hour, eliminating costly manual sampling. Utility operators embed photodiodes within switchgear to detect early arc-flash signatures, pre-empting outages. Because these installations lock customers into multi-year calibration and analytics contracts, stationary solutions generate predictable after-sales income that cushions vendors against smartphone-cycle volatility. Over time, artificial-intelligence upgrades further enhance data value and extend replacement intervals.

Consumer electronics set the cadence for innovation in photodetector pixel density, quantum efficiency, and power budget. Each flagship smartphone integrates a growing constellation of optical modules—structured-light projectors for secure face unlock, laser autofocus, depth-sensing SPAD arrays, and ambient-color sensors that tune display white balance in real time. Smart-TV OEMs add gesture-recognition cameras to remote-free interfaces, while VR headsets string four or more inside-out tracking cameras around the visor, each dependent on high-frame-rate photodiodes with low dark current. The fierce feature race forces yearly redesigns, compressing product lifecycles and driving wafer starts at mixed-signal foundries. Volume economics from this consumer onslaught cascade into industrial and medical tiers, lowering barriers for niche deployments. Accessory ecosystems—ring lights, gimbals, and AR spectacles—likewise embed auxiliary photodetectors, magnifying aggregate demand.

ADAS multiplies photodetector channels per car. Solid-state lidar arrays use dense SPAD networks to perceive pedestrians in fog, while interior driver-monitoring cameras employ NIR sensors to track distraction. Euro-NCAP protocols now demand automatic emergency braking and intelligent speed assistance, making multi-spectral optical sensing mandatory for five-star safety ratings. Tier-one suppliers sign decade-long volume contracts, ensuring foundry utilization. Premium carmakers differentiate with 4D lidar featuring single-photon avalanche diodes capable of picosecond timing, commanding high ASPs. Automotive qualification cycles create durable revenue annuities, while over-the-air firmware updates unlock advanced features, encouraging owners to subscribe, further monetizing embedded photodetectors.

In point-of-care diagnostics, photodetectors form the critical read-out engine that turns biochemical reactions into quantifiable digital signals within minutes. Disposable test cartridges—ranging from lateral-flow COVID assays to microfluidic HbA1c panels—use embedded photodiodes or compact CMOS sensors to measure colorimetric or fluorescent changes produced by antigen–antibody binding or enzymatic activity. Because these detectors can resolve subtle intensity shifts, clinicians obtain lab-comparable accuracy at the bedside or pharmacy counter without bulky spectrophotometers. Pharmacy chains bundle readers with subscription data services, generating predictable consumable pull-through. Developing economies adopt low-cost photodiode readers to offset limited lab infrastructure, broadening geographic revenue.

LEED, BREEAM, and national green codes mandate daylight harvesting and occupancy-based lighting controls, all dependent on lux and presence detection. Ultra-low-dark-current diodes keep standby power at micro-watt level, vital for sensor grids in commercial campuses. Performance-contract financiers bundle hardware, installation, and savings guarantees, shifting CapEx to OpEx and accelerating upgrades. LED-driver ICs now ship with integrated photodiode feedback loops, simplifying design and boosting attach rates. Carbon-reduction targets create repeat retrofit cycles as efficacy thresholds tighten.

Hyperspectral drones and satellite surveys rely on high-QE detector arrays to monitor nitrogen uptake, fungal infections, and water stress at centimetre resolution. Variable-rate applicators cut fertilizer and pesticide usage up to thirty percent, justifying sensor investment. Governments subsidize agritech drones to meet sustainable-yield targets, injecting predictable demand. Commodity traders and crop-insurance firms pay for real-time imagery, creating secondary revenue channels for detector OEMs.

PHOTO DETECTOR MARKET SHARE

Asia-Pacific commands over half of global shipments, buoyed by China’s smartphone corridors, South Korea’s display fabs, and Japan’s automotive-camera exports; semiconductor-sovereignty subsidies multiply wafer lines and shorten supply chains.

North America and Europe together generate roughly one-third of revenue, driven by defense imaging, quantum research, and stringent safety rules that lift unit ASPs. Latin America and MEA trail in volume yet post double-digit growth through smart-city and agritech pilots, providing geographic diversification that cushions cyclical downturns.

WASHINGTON, May 23, 2025 /PRNewswire/ — NASA has awarded a bridge contract to ASRC Federal System Solutions LLC of Beltsville, Maryland, to provide financial support and project planning and control services to the agency.

The Program Analysis and Control Bridge Contract has a total potential value up to $98 million with a 13-month period of performance beginning Saturday, May 24. The contract includes both cost-plus-fixed-fee and indefinite-delivery/indefinite-quantity components.

The scope of the work includes business functions such as accounting, scheduling, documentation and configuration management, as well as security compliance. The work will occur at NASA Headquarters in Washington, Goddard Space Flight Center in Greenbelt, Maryland, and Langley Research Center in Hampton, Virginia.

KNOXVILLE, Tenn., May 23, 2025 /PRNewswire/ — Avèro Advisors, a nationally recognized independent consulting firm specializing in public sector transformation, is pleased to announce it has been selected by Tarrant County, Texas to provide Enterprise Resource Planning (ERP) advisory services. Through this partnership, Avèro will conduct a county-wide evaluation of the current ERP landscape and operational workflows, providing expert insight to help the County plan for the future.

Tarrant County awarded Avèro the contract following a competitive procurement process. The initiative centers on a detailed needs assessment and strategic analysis of business functions across County departments. The findings will guide leadership in identifying improvement opportunities and establishing a clear, actionable roadmap—whether that involves optimizing the existing system or pursuing other enhancements.

“Good decisions begin with a clear understanding of where you are,” said Abhijit Verekar, CEO of Avèro Advisors. “Tarrant County is taking a thoughtful, data-driven approach to evaluating its ERP environment. Our role is to provide the expert guidance they need to uncover the right path forward—with clarity, confidence, and a commitment to their long-term success.”

Key Objectives of the Engagement:

ERP Environment Assessment: Review of the County’s current ERP ecosystem, including technology, user experience, and functional alignment across departments.
Operational Workflow Analysis: Detailed documentation and evaluation of core business functions to uncover pain points, duplication, and modernization opportunities.
Strategic Roadmap Development: Creation of a future-oriented plan that aligns technology investments with operational priorities—tailored to County goals.
Optional Support for Future Procurement: Advisory services may extend to vendor evaluation and implementation support should the County choose to pursue changes.

This engagement reflects Tarrant County’s commitment to proactive governance, fiscal responsibility, and continuous improvement through technology and process alignment.
